Chimeric Allergen Receptor Treg Cells Suppress Allergic Asthma in Mice

Researchers developed chimeric allergen receptor regulatory T cells (CAlleR Tregs) that suppressed allergic asthma symptoms in mice sensitized to birch pollen allergen, demonstrating potential for treating various allergies in humans.
